Web3j-NFT is an extension built on the foundations of the Java-based Web3j library, enabling developers to integrate blockchain NFT functionalities into their applications with ease. Its design aims to simplify the creation and management of NFTs in the Ethereum ecosystem. Web3j-NFT is distributed under the Apache 2.0 license—an open source license renowned for its permissiveness and robust legal protection to contributors and users. The license encourages developers to build on the project without significant legal overhead while ensuring that contributions remain free and open.
